    A frequent misconception is that weekly rentals are only affordable when booked last minute. In reality, booking early or aligning rentals with off-peak demand creates optimal pricing—just like smart shoppers plan sales. Another myth: all weekly rates are built the same. Choice matters: providers differ in insurance coverage, vehicle condition, and customer support, which all affect value.

    The rise in popularity reflects shifting travel habits and economic realities. With rising gas prices, unpredictable public transit fares, and growing interest in flexible work locations, many households are reevaluating weekly car rentals as a practical alternative to vehicle ownership. Digital tools now let users compare rates, access real-time deals, and plan seamless bookings—no fluff required.
